Transaction d6efd80f9ac35dc7f592f4e76f578bf495d76cc696734522d14287401ac8fd46

3 Input
2 Outputs
  • d6efd80f9ac35dc7f592f4e76f578bf495d76cc696734522d14287401ac8fd46:0
  • value  2878637
    address  34noh63GtRVxgRuUzJ9GYaAYiSMXsxZtD4
  • d6efd80f9ac35dc7f592f4e76f578bf495d76cc696734522d14287401ac8fd46:1
  • value  348916
    address  1QCcWQg63QG8UKhsbBD8xKueQfKfCZYg2p